Many, but not all, z/OS systems restrict the names of jobs submitted from TSO to the TSO ID plus one (valid) character. I have not seen anything that explicitly says that this is or isn't the case on FanDeZhi; is it so?

If you submit from ISPF Edit or View, the restriction is that your jobname must begin with your userid, and you can use any additional characters up to the maximum of eight characters.

If you submit any other way there are no restrictions, but you can expect to be revoked pretty quickly, as the admins, yours truly included, do not like this practice!
